> BigQuery IO does not support bytes in Python 3

> In Python 2 you could write bytes data to BigQuery. This is tested in
>  
> [https://github.com/apache/beam/blob/master/sdks/python/apache_beam/io/gcp/big_query_query_to_table_it_test.py#L186]
> Python 3 does not support
> {noformat}
> json.dumps({'test': b'test'}){noformat}
> which is used to encode the data in
>  
> [https://github.com/apache/beam/blob/master/sdks/python/apache_beam/io/gcp/bigquery_tools.py#L959]
>  
> How should writing bytes to BigQuery be handled in Python 3?
>  * Forbid writing bytes into BigQuery on Python 3
>  * Guess the encoding (utf-8?)
>  * Pass the encoding to BigQuery
